Sam, Choi, Mich, Pia, and Sheen are on a 6’ x 4’ rectangular balsa. They are having trouble keeping the balsa balanced as they are unaware of their center of mass. Find their center of mass, given the following:

Sam is at 3 feet east, and 2 feet north of the balsa’s geometric center. She weighs 78 kg.

Choi is 2 feet east, and 2 feet south of the geometric center. He weighs 52 kg.

Mich is the geometric center of the balsa. He weighs 45 kg.

Pia is at 4 feet west, and 2 feet south of the geometric center. She weighs 56 kg.

Sheen is at 1 foot west of the balsa’s geometric center. She weighs 75 kg.

Finally, we have all info to find the center of mass! Choose the system of coordinates: the geometric center is zero, up/right is positive, left/down is negative:


yc=y1m1+y2m2+y3m3+y4m4+y5m5m1+m2+m3+m4+m5, yc=278+(2)52+045+(2)56+07578+52+45+56+75=0.2 ft South. xc=x1m1+x2m2+x3m3+x4m4+x5m5m1+m2+m3+m4+m5, xc=378+252+045+(4)56+(1)7578+52+45+56+75=0.13 ft East.y_c=\frac{y_1m_1+y_2m_2+y_3m_3+y_4m_4+y_5m_5}{m_1+m_2+m_3+m_4+m_5},\\\space\\ y_c=\frac{2·78+(-2)·52+0·45+(-2)·56+0·75}{78+52+45+56+75}=0.2\text{ ft South}.\\\space\\ x_c=\frac{x_1m_1+x_2m_2+x_3m_3+x_4m_4+x_5m_5}{m_1+m_2+m_3+m_4+m_5},\\\space\\ x_c=\frac{3·78+2·52+0·45+(-4)·56+(-1)·75}{78+52+45+56+75}=0.13\text{ ft East}.
